Road Safety, Family Stops, and Fatigue Management
Infrastructure safety is high on I-90, but the Taconic State Parkway has sharp curves and limited shoulders. Road quality varies; watch for potholes in spring. Winter driving conditions are common.
- Rest areas: I-90 offers modern rest stops with clean restrooms, vending, and picnic areas. Taconic has few facilities.
- Family-friendly stops: The Children's Museum of Science and Technology (Troy, NY), Berkshire Museum (Pittsfield, MA).
- Pet-friendly stops: Many rest areas allow pets on leashes. Letchworth State Park has designated pet-friendly trails.
For fatigue management, plan stops every 2 hours. Hidden off-route spots include the Thomas Cole National Historic Site in Catskill, NY, and the Olana State Historic Site in Hudson, NY, both offering stunning Hudson River views.
- Thomas Cole Site: Admission $12. Guided tours of the artist's home. Open May-October.
- Olana: Frederic Church's mansion. Tours from $14. Grounds open year-round.
Natural Landscapes and Local Commerce
Things to do between Buffalo, NY and Lenox, MA include exploring the Finger Lakes wine region, Letchworth State Park (the Grand Canyon of the East), and the Hudson River School art sites. The route passes through the Catskill Park and the scenic Hudson Valley.
- Letchworth State Park: 3 waterfalls, 66 miles of trails. Entry $10 per vehicle. Best stop for hiking and photography.
- Howe Caverns: Limestone caves near Cobleskill, NY. 1 hour guided tours. Open year-round.
- Berkshire Botanical Garden: In Stockbridge, MA. 15 acres of display gardens. Seasonal.
Local commerce highlights include farm stands along NY-22 in Columbia County and the artisan community in Great Barrington, MA. The region is known for apples, maple syrup, and cheese.
- Apple orchards: Windy Hill Orchard (Ghent, NY) - U-pick available.
- Cheese: Berkshire Cheese Shop (Great Barrington) - Local artisan cheeses.
Route Logistics and Infrastructure
Fuel costs for this route average $40-$60 depending on vehicle efficiency. Toll roads include I-90 (Mass Pike) with tolls around $15 total. Gas stations are plentiful along I-90, but sparse on the Taconic; fill up before exiting.
- Major highways: I-90 East (New York State Thruway), I-87 South (Albany), Taconic State Parkway
- Alternative scenic route: US-20 (longer, historic) or NY-22 (through Berkshires)
- Navigation app recommendation: Waze for real-time traffic; Google Maps for alternate routes
